How does Benenden Healthcare work?
We work alongside the NHS, so if it’s unable to meet your needs, we step in and let you know what help we can offer. That gives you a safety net you might not otherwise have.

When it comes to accessing our services, we trust you to use your judgement in deciding whether your health problems can be resolved by the NHS or other means. Because we’re not medical insurers, there are times where we might not be able to guarantee services, but we will usually endeavour to help you find the help you need if we can’t provide it ourselves. Our services are considered based on your needs and available Society resources; this is described as ‘discretionary’. In addition, you do not pay insurance premium tax on contributions.
Treatment for tuberculosis is provided on a non-discretionary basis.
All other services are provided at the discretion of the Society. Members must discuss their needs with us and receive written authorisation in advance, before you can arrange or obtain any services that you wish the Society to support.
Overseas members
If you’re currently not a resident in the UK, the services you are entitled to will be restricted to Information Services:
- GP 24/7 telephone advice line
- 24/7 Stress counselling helpline
- Long term care advice line
- The health concern advice line
Once you return to the UK to live, you will need to be registered with a UK GP and test the NHS before requesting consultation, physiotherapy or treatment services.
